ZIP code 21160 in Whiteford, Maryland has a population of 2,408. The median household income is $106,181, which is 39% above the national average. Median home value is $391,300, 41% above the US average. 22.5%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her.

ZIP code 21160 is classified by USPS as a standard delivery area and covers roughly 42.8 square miles in Whiteford, Harford County, Maryland. The area is home to 2,408 residents, producing a population density of 56 people per square mile, and falls within the New York time zone. These USPS and Census boundary values drive every downstream statistic on this page, including the benchmarks that compare 21160 against Maryland and the nation.

On the economic side, the median household income for ZIP 21160 sits at $106,181 (7% below the Maryland average), while per-capita income is $51,491. The poverty rate stands at 11.4% and the unemployment rate at 3.7%. On housing, the median home value is $391,300 (13% below the state average) with median rent at per month, and 81.1% of occupied units are owner-occupied, a direct signal of whether 21160 behaves more like a homeowner neighborhood or a renter-heavy ZIP.

Education and household profile round out the picture: 22.5%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, the median age is 52.7, and the average commute is 44 minutes. Census Bureau data shows 71 business establishments in ZIP 21160, employing approximately 753 people with a combined annual payroll of $51,435,000.
